I just finished the first semester in the evening section. I was active at this board but of course it was impossible to do so while at school :D.

Just wanted to say goodluck to everyone and I hope to bump into those planning to attend the evening class. My advice for the afternoon and evening class (as I know who your professor is going to be :p) is to listen to lectures very hard, take careful notes, even bring a recorder if needed.

You will find (as others before me warned) that exams are very different in nursing class and that critical thinking is a definite must. Take time to read your books associated with the lectures everyday if possible because it will be very difficult if you cram a few days before the exam :uhoh3: (found this the hard way).

If anybody has questions, I will try to answer them as soon as I can. Right now, I am also starting to read some of the books for Nursing 2 (Maternity and Psych) that we are already required to buy. :eek:
